MY TEACHER GLOWS IN THE DARK -- Bruce Coville

A Minstrel Book -- tpb
New York -- ©1991 -- 137pp
ISBN: 0-671-72709-5
illustrated by John Pierard

After discovering that his teacher is an alien, a young boy begs to be taken aboard an intergalactic space ship, where he becomes Earth's last chance at survival.

#####

Although I really like Bruce Coville books, I had put off reading this because I thought, from the title, that it was going to be one of his silly books. Instead, it was some pretty serious, youthful, sci-fi, and I enjoyed it much more than I was expecting. The book actually deals with a young boy's perceptions of loneliness, friendship, and girls all within the environment of space, aliens, and the end of the world.

I'm sorry, now, that I didn't read the other two books in the series first.

Recommended.
